Abstract
An image processing system with a quality assurance feature is disclosed for determining the quality of the images being processed. The system includes a plurality of sections operating independently and concurrently to insure reliability. One section includes calculation of a quality assurance parameter dependent on the fill factor and the compression ratio determined before and after compression respectively. A second section includes histogram hardware for generating qualified histograms representative of foreground data, and background data transitions and a comparator for detecting overlap therebetween. A third section develops a histogram parameter based on the areas of the histograms and compares this parameter to the quality assurance parameter for concurrence. The system also includes autosizing means for detecting the borders of an image using fuzzy logic.
